Yeah, this is a great documentary. This whole underground scene of "classic" video gamers is a strange one. There's definitely an insiders club that has existed since the 70s, and it's fun to watch someone new try to break into that world.
I mean, this poor guy had the skills but had to prove himself over and over again to these losers. First they wouldn't accept his video tape, then they claimed his machine was fixed, then he had to play the video game live... finally he just flew out to their local arcade and entered their tournament.
I had no idea that trying to break a record on something so trivial as Donkey Kong would be this dramatic. I went in to the movie expecting something like a nostalgia piece about classic video games... just framed by this story of an obscure Donkey Kong rivalry. But it was a really great story about people. Thank God that Steve Wiebe was such a nice, genuine person... because you really start to cheer for him. Eventually he even wins over a few of the old school guys. I suppose it's kind of a feel good movie~
It's definitely worth the effort to see this movie if it rolls through your town.
